Based on last year, I've heard it's hirevue-> superday. No phone calls or interviews in between. However, the hirevues screening is pretty selective and not everyone gets them. It's not like MS who gives a hirevue to anyone with a heart beat that has above a 3.0 GPA.

 

It's rolling so it will depend on when you apply. They do it in pools based on date of application received and what school you go to. Unfortunately, I don't know the % of people that get superdays given that they got the hirevue.
